Watch: Stanford beats Notre Dame 38–36 on game-winning field goal

In a tight edition of their annual rivalry, No. 9 Stanford topped No. 6 Notre Dame 38–36 on a game-winning field goal.
No team ever led by more than a touchdown in this one, and DeShone Kizer punched in a short touchdown to give the Irish a late 36–35 lead. But the Cardinal got one last shot, and senior quarterback Kevin Hogan (who threw four touchdowns on the night) led a game-winning drive capped by a 27-yard pass to Devon Cajuste to get Stanford in field goal range.
Kicker Conrad Ukropina lined up for a 45-yarder that split the uprights.

The loss drops Notre Dame to 10–2 and likely knocks it out of contention for a College Football Playoff spot. Stanford moves to 10-2 and will play in the Pac-12 Championship game against USC next week.
